I have been the IT administrator for Student Residences at the UofM for about 20 years now and seen many changes. 😊
There is a central IT department that looks after the enterprise systems but also has an IT help desk with staff that support some faculties.
I’m what they now refer to as “distributed IT” and my position is funded through my department.
We have 4 buildings and about 1200 beds.
Each building has university provided WiFi and two have university provided ethernet. One building has DSL.
I run a residence Internet help desk with students that we hire to provide tier one support. I have an assistant that helps me and provides tier two support. The tough problems get sent to me as the final tier. 😊
One of our biggest challenges is when students bring in devices that broadcast a WiFi signal.
This causes the university provided WiFi to be not-so-great for others around them.
Can any of you relate to this and how do you handle it?
